Home
last modified time | relevance | path

Searched refs:hpc_reg (Results 1 – 3 of 3) sorted by relevance

/linux-2.4.37.9/drivers/hotplug/
Dcpqphp.h295 void *hpc_reg; /* cookie for our pci controller location */ member
536 misc = readw(ctrl->hpc_reg + MISC); in set_SOGO()
538 writew(misc, ctrl->hpc_reg + MISC); in set_SOGO()
546 led_control = readl(ctrl->hpc_reg + LED_CONTROL); in amber_LED_on()
548 writel(led_control, ctrl->hpc_reg + LED_CONTROL); in amber_LED_on()
556 led_control = readl(ctrl->hpc_reg + LED_CONTROL); in amber_LED_off()
558 writel(led_control, ctrl->hpc_reg + LED_CONTROL); in amber_LED_off()
566 led_control = readl(ctrl->hpc_reg + LED_CONTROL); in read_amber_LED()
577 led_control = readl(ctrl->hpc_reg + LED_CONTROL); in green_LED_on()
579 writel(led_control, ctrl->hpc_reg + LED_CONTROL); in green_LED_on()
[all …]
Dcpqphp_core.c181 number_of_slots = readb(ctrl->hpc_reg + SLOT_MASK) & 0x0F; in init_SERR()
185 writeb(0, ctrl->hpc_reg + SLOT_SERR); in init_SERR()
325 tempdword = readl(ctrl->hpc_reg + INT_INPUT_CLEAR); in ctrl_slot_setup()
327 number_of_slots = readb(ctrl->hpc_reg + SLOT_MASK) & 0x0F; in ctrl_slot_setup()
328 slot_device = readb(ctrl->hpc_reg + SLOT_MASK) >> 4; in ctrl_slot_setup()
390 ctrl_slot = slot_device - (readb(ctrl->hpc_reg + SLOT_MASK) >> 4); in ctrl_slot_setup()
453 iounmap(ctrl->hpc_reg); in ctrl_slot_cleanup()
1109 ctrl->hpc_reg = ioremap(pci_resource_start(pdev, 0), pci_resource_len(pdev, 0)); in cpqhpc_probe()
1110 if (!ctrl->hpc_reg) { in cpqhpc_probe()
1132 …rc = get_slot_mapping(ctrl->pci_ops, pdev->bus->number, (readb(ctrl->hpc_reg + SLOT_MASK) >> 4), &… in cpqhpc_probe()
[all …]
Dcpqphp_ctrl.c189 p_slot = cpqhp_find_slot(ctrl, hp_slot + (readb(ctrl->hpc_reg + SLOT_MASK) >> 4)); in handle_presence_change()
925 misc = readw(ctrl->hpc_reg + MISC); in cpqhp_ctrl_intr()
940 writew(misc, ctrl->hpc_reg + MISC); in cpqhp_ctrl_intr()
943 misc = readw(ctrl->hpc_reg + MISC); in cpqhp_ctrl_intr()
951 Diff = readl(ctrl->hpc_reg + INT_INPUT_CLEAR) ^ ctrl->ctrl_int_comp; in cpqhp_ctrl_intr()
953 ctrl->ctrl_int_comp = readl(ctrl->hpc_reg + INT_INPUT_CLEAR); in cpqhp_ctrl_intr()
956 writel(Diff, ctrl->hpc_reg + INT_INPUT_CLEAR); in cpqhp_ctrl_intr()
959 temp_dword = readl(ctrl->hpc_reg + INT_INPUT_CLEAR); in cpqhp_ctrl_intr()
963 writel(0xFFFFFFFF, ctrl->hpc_reg + INT_INPUT_CLEAR); in cpqhp_ctrl_intr()
971 reset = readb(ctrl->hpc_reg + RESET_FREQ_MODE); in cpqhp_ctrl_intr()
[all …]